Remote sensing function
Use this function when it is desirable to automatically compensate for
voltage drops in the load line.
The remote sensing function is operated by connS terminal (2
pin on CN) to +side of the load terminal and -S terminal (4 pin on CN)
to -side of the load terminal.
When the remote sensing function is not used, using a connector
provided as standard enables the connection bS and +V
terminals (1 pin on CN) and between -S and -V terminals (3 pin on
CN) respectively.

Remote control function
This function is to turn ON/OFF the output by an external signal using
+RC terminal (7 pin on CN) and -RC terminal (8 pin on CN) while input
voltage remains applied. To use this function, connect a switch or a
transistor to +RC and -RC terminals.
When not in use, use the standard supplied connector to short-circuit
+RC and -RC terminals.
Max. applied voltage: 12 V max., Counter voltage: -1 V max.,
Sink current: 3.5 mA
Note: 1.
If counter voltage is applied to remote control terminals,
output voltage cannot be turned ON/OFF.
Please remember this when wiring.
2.
Use a twist wire or a two-core shield wire for connection line.
3.
Remote control circuit is disconnected from input and output
circuits.
4.
Remove a connector provided as standard and prepare a
harness separately.
Alarm detection function
When output voltage drops due to overcurrent protection, overvoltage
protection, or overheat protection in operation or input voltage drop,
when the built-in fan stops, or when the Power Supply goes standby
by remote control, the alarm indicator (LED: red) lights up to indicate
the output voltage trouble. In addition, the transistor outputs that
outside.
Transistor output: 30 VDC max., 50 mA max.
Residual voltage when the function is ON: 2 V max., leakage current
when the function is OFF: 0.1 mA max.
Detection voltage: approximately 80% of the output voltage setting
value
When trouble is detected, the transistor output is turned OFF
(nonconductive pins 11-12 on CN) and the LED (red) lights up.
Note: 1.
The alarm detection function monitors the voltage at the
Power Supply output end. To check an accurate voltage,
measure a voltage at the load end.
2.
Remove the standard supplied connector and prepare a
connector separately.
Overload Protection
The Power Supply is provided with an overload protection function
that protects the power supply from possible damage by overcurrent.
When the output current rises above 105% to 160% min. of the rated
current, the protection function is triggered, decreasing the output
voltage. When the output current falls within the rated range, the
overload protection function is automatically cleared.
Note: 1.
When a load is connected that has a built-in DC-DC
converter, the overload protection may operate at startup
and the power supply may not start.
2.
Internal parts may occasionally deteriorate or be damaged
if a short-circuited or overcurrent state continues during
operation.
3.
Internal parts may possibly deteriorate or be damaged if the
Power Supply is used for applications with frequent inrush
current or overloading at the load end. Do not use the Power
Supply for such applications.
